
"ChaseR A Novel in E-mails" offers a fresh and relatable perspective on the experience of moving, a significant life event for many children. Told entirely through email correspondence, the story captures the protagonist's initial anxieties, the process of adjusting to a new rural setting, and the efforts to build new friendships while maintaining old connections. This format makes the narrative feel immediate and personal, allowing young readers to deeply connect with the character's emotional journey of adaptation and resilience. It's ideal for children aged 4-11 who are facing or have recently experienced a move, or simply enjoy stories about friendship and overcoming change.
Advanced System Modelling and Simulation with Block Diagram Languages explores and describes the use of block languages in dynamic modelling and simulation. The application of block diagrams to dynamic modelling is reviewed, not only in terms of known components and systems, but also in terms of the development of new systems. Methods by which block diagrams clarify the dynamic essence of systems and their components are emphasized throughout the book, and sufficient introductory material is included to elucidate the book's advanced material. Widely used continuous dynamic system simulation (CDSS) languages are analyzed, and their technical features are discussed. This self-contained resource includes a review section on block diagram algebra and applied transfer functions, both of which are important mathematical subjects, relevant to the understanding of continuous dynamic system simulation.
